Every hour spent sitting down increases the risk of cancer by nearly a tenth

Each extra hour sitting down may raise your risk of deadly cancer, a study suggests. The average American spends between six and 10 hours a day sitting and engaging in sedentary behaviors like watching TV or working at a desk. Science has long... Read more.
